Frequently asked questions about Friendsville Elementary
How many students attend Friendsville Elementary?
Friendsville Elementary has 212 students enrolled. It is an elementary school in Friendsville, TN. CCD year-over-year: 214 (2022-23) → 208 (2023-24), nearly flat (-6).
What is the student-teacher ratio at Friendsville Elementary?
The student-teacher ratio at Friendsville Elementary is 14.1:1, which is 8% lower than the Tennessee average of 15.3:1 and 10% lower than the national average of 15.7:1. Lower ratios generally mean more individual attention per student.
What is the racial and ethnic makeup of Friendsville Elementary?
The largest demographic group at Friendsville Elementary is White at 90.6% of enrollment, in Friendsville, TN.
What is the Resource Investment Index for Friendsville Elementary?
Friendsville Elementary has a Resource Investment Index of 53/100 (higher reported resources relative to schools nationally) based on 4 factors: student-teacher ratio, gifted-program reporting, counselor availability, chronic absenteeism. Not a test-score or academic measure (national median ~41/100, see methodology).
How does Friendsville Elementary rank among public schools in Friendsville?
By Resource Investment Index, Friendsville Elementary ranks #1 of 3 public schools in Friendsville, TN. This compares federal resource and staffing data among local peers; it is not a test-score or academic ranking.
